Today, we’re cracking the silence on a topic that deeply affects so many in our community, yet often doesn’t receive the attention it truly deserves—a true infertility journey. March is a month dedicated to raising awareness around endometriosis, surrogacy, and cervical health. These crucial health issues are often overlooked, and we’re honored to have Dae with us on the podcast to discuss their personal battle with infertility and the emotional manipulation that many go through—gaslighting in the infertility process.
Dae is a true survivor who faced years of infertility struggles, unanswered questions, and dismissive doctors with incredible strength and resilience. Despite emotional exhaustion and countless challenges, Dae never gave up on advocating for their health. Their story is one of courage, and by sharing it, they hope to empower others who feel isolated in their own journey.
In this episode, we unpack how gaslighting manifests in the infertility process, the impact it has on mental health, and why it’s so crucial to speak out and seek support. Dae's journey is a powerful reminder that you are not alone, and it’s okay to challenge medical professionals and societal expectations when it comes to your health.
Tune in as we dive deep into Dae's personal story, discuss the importance of advocating for your health, and shed light on how we can support each other through this painful, yet powerful, journey.

Ruthie's Table 4
For more than 30 years The River Cafe in London, has been the home-from-home of artists, architects, designers, actors, collectors, writers, activists, and politicians. Michael Caine, Glenn Close, JJ Abrams, Steve McQueen, Victoria and David Beckham, and Lily Allen, are just some of the people who love to call The River Cafe home. On River Cafe Table 4, Rogers sits down with her customers—who have become friends—to talk about food memories. Table 4 explores how food impacts every aspect of our lives. “Foods is politics, food is cultural, food is how you express love, food is about your heritage, it defines who you and who you want to be,” says Rogers. Each week, Rogers invites her guest to reminisce about family suppers and first dates, what they cook, how they eat when performing, the restaurants they choose, and what food they seek when they need comfort. And to punctuate each episode of Table 4, guests such as Ralph Fiennes, Emily Blunt, and Alfonso Cuarón, read their favourite recipe from one of the best-selling River Cafe cookbooks. Table 4 itself, is situated near The River Cafe’s open kitchen, close to the bright pink wood-fired oven and next to the glossy yellow pass, where Ruthie oversees the restaurant. You are invited to take a seat at this intimate table and join the conversation.
